The Unicode block "Cuneiform" covers the ancient writing system used by the Sumerians, Akkadians, Babylonians, Assyrians, and other Mesopotamian cultures. This block includes characters used in cuneiform inscriptions, which were typically written on clay tablets using a wedge-shaped stylus. The Cuneiform block in Unicode encompasses symbols and signs for writing in various languages of the region, allowing for the digital representation of these ancient texts.
